The preparation of titanium dioxide nanoparticles capped with stearate by s
ol-gel methods is presented in this paper. The nanoparticles are characteri
zed by Fourier transform infrared spectroscopy and by X-ray photoelectron s
pectroscopy. Existence of the organic layer can be confirmed by the results
of characterizations, which also indicate that the inorganic nuclei and or
ganic surface layer are linked with chemical bonds. The nanoparticles are p
oorly crystallized based on the X-ray diffraction pattern. The mechanism of
formation of the organo-capped nanoparticles is proposed to be competitive
reactions between water and stearic acid, which is similar to a polymeriza
tion and inhibition processes. A structural model for organo-capped nanopar
ticles is also proposed, (C) 2000 Academic Press.
